Melissa Cheesman Smith
Melissa Cheesman Smith is an author of professional literacy resources and an experienced classroom teacher at both the elementary and college levels. She holds a Master’s of Education in Curriculum and Instruction and has been described as a veteran fifth-grade teacher and Arizona State University faculty associate, with a focus on helping educators integrate effective reading fluency instruction into daily practice. She lives in Mesa, Arizona, with her husband and three children.
Smith is the coauthor, with Timothy V. Rasinski, of The Megabook of Fluency and The Megabook of Fluency, 2nd Edition: Strategies and Texts to Engage All Readers, comprehensive resources that provide more than 50 fluency strategies and accompanying texts for grades K–8. She is also a published author of other literacy professional books, including The Megabook of Vocabulary: Strategies to Boost Word Learning for Reading, Writing, Speaking, and Listening, and has contributed to materials such as word ladders that support word study and fluency development.
